With human figures being the preferred theme and hallmark for Khalil Ibrahim, we are presented with a mesmerizing acrylic piece of colourful, hypnotising women moving across the canvas.

The employment of bright, enlivening colours creates an overall enthusiastic and energetic mood. Silhouettes of various individuals are situated mainly in the center, where Khalil’s penchant for the human body is exhibited – he paints the curves, contours and forms expertly.

In entirety, this piece is reminiscent of wayang kulit, given its flat depths.

Khalil Ibrahim graduated from the prestigious St. Martin’s School of Art & Design, United Kingdom in 1964. Thereafter, he became a full-time artist and has been so for fifty years now. He has held solo and group exhibitions in Malaysia, Singapore, Indonesia and Switzerland, with most of his works center around figures and are heavily influenced by East Coast fishermen and women.
